TROPICAL WEATHER OUTLOOK

Patches of low level cloud drifting along the wind flow will cause a few showers over the region during the next 24 hours.

…… Tropical Storm Paulette ……

At 5:00 am today, the center of Tropical Storm Paulette was located near latitude 20.9 degrees north, longitude 49.0 degrees west or about 935 miles or 1505 kilometers east-northeast of the Northern Leeward Islands. Paulette is moving toward the west-northwest near 10 mph or 17 km/h. Maximum sustained winds are near 60 mph or 95 km/h with higher gusts.

…… Tropical Storm Rene……

At 5:00 pm today, the center of Tropical Storm Rene was located over the eastern tropical Atlantic near latitude 18.2 degrees north and longitude 34.8 degrees west. Rene is moving toward the west-northwest near 13 mph or 20 km/h. Maximum sustained winds are near 40 mph or 65 km/h with higher gusts.

Both of these systems are forecast to remain over the open Atlantic Ocean and are not expected to pose a direct threat to the Lesser Antilles.

A tropical wave is forecast to emerge off the west coast of Africa later today. This wave has a high chance of tropical cyclone development during the next five days. The Saint Lucia Meteorological Services will continue to closely monitor and provide updates on the progress of these systems.
